Most Common Issues Reported in the AV and Evidence Based Solutions 

ACADEMIC

Organization, Predictability, Manipulatives, Prompting, Breaking Down Tasks, Classroom Expectations, Explicit Instruction .

ADAPTIVE/SELF-HELP

Avoiding Learned Helplessness, Hygiene, Grooming, Daily Living, Independence, Life Skills, Personal Care

CHALLENGING BEHAVIOR

Behaviors that interfere with ability to learn, Refusal, Not Attending, Rigidity, Avoidance, Non-Compliance, Accepting Consequence and Criticism.

COMMUNICATION

Expressing Wants, Needs, Choices, Feelings, Sharing Ideas, Participating in Discussions, Using Pictures to Communicate

SCHOOL READINESS

Attention, Engagement, Motivation, Transitions, Task Completion, Independence, Following Directions


SENSORY/MOTOR

Movement or Motion, Fine and Gross Motor, Related to Sensory System/Sensory Functioning. 

SOCIAL

Peer Engagement, Verbal and Non-verbal communication, Making Friends, Turn-Taking, Conversations, Manners, Greetings, Asking for Help

VOCATIONAL

Work readiness skills, Time Management, Working with others, Working independently, Career Exploration
